August 7 is Nose Day
Young children understand that August 7 is a day to take care of their noses, and learn the role of the nose and gentle habits to help prevent illness
💬 August 7 is Nose Day
August 7 is Nose Day. It is called Nose Day because of “ha” and “na.” It is a day to think about taking good care of our noses.

💬 What does the nose do?
The nose is where we smell things. We can smell flowers and the smell of food. It also becomes the pathway for air when we breathe.

💬 Things we can do to protect our noses
When we come home from outside, we wash our hands. We try not to touch our noses with dirty hands. We gently wipe a runny nose with a tissue.

💬 Tell someone when your nose feels uncomfortable
Sometimes we get a runny nose. Sometimes we sneeze or have a stuffy nose. When it feels uncomfortable, let an adult know.
